Common Causes of Back Discomfort in Ladies
Identifying the sources of female lumbar discomfort is key toward proper diagnosis and care. Here are some major contributors:
1. Endocrine Shifts
Women undergo hormonal fluctuations throughout different life stages, including the menstrual cycle, pregnancy, and menopause. These hormonal changes affects joint stability and trigger discomfort, increasing the risk of pain.
2. Maternal Changes
Lumbar discomfort among expectant mothers is one of the most common complaints. Fetal development changes body alignment, putting strain on the spine. Additionally, hormonal adjustments, that prepares the body for childbirth, also contributes to back discomfort.
3. Muscle Strain
Poor sitting habits, heavy lifting, or lack of physical activity often overloads the spine in the back muscles. Over time, such strain results in long-term discomfort, get more info particularly among office workers.
4. Gynecological Conditions
Health issues including menstrual-related issues, non-cancerous growths, or gynecological diseases can result in lower left back pain in women. Such pain often radiates from the lower abdomen to the spinal area, necessitating professional care to ensure effective relief.
5. Age-Related Back Issues
Spinal problems including bulging spinal discs, nerve compression, or age-related joint issues often lead to persistent discomfort, especially in older women. Such disorders need medical diagnosis from trained professionals for effective management.
